Project Overview
Name and Creator: LOOPDOT: World's First Pixel Display EDC Flashlight & Fidget Dial by LOOPGEAR.
What It Is: The LOOPDOT is a compact, high performance EDC flashlight that integrates a full-color RGB pixel display and a fidget dial. It is designed to be more than a simple tool, offering features like custom animations, mini games, and a unique, tactile user interface. The device combines a high CRI flashlight with a playful, interactive gadget in a single aluminum or titanium body.
Key Features
World's First Pixel Display: The LOOPDOT's standout feature is its 52 large RGB pixel display. This is not just for decoration. It shows custom animations, mini games like rock paper scissors, and communicates useful information such as battery status in a visually engaging way.
Tactile Fidget Dial: The device is controlled by a smooth, tactile rotating bezel or fidget dial. This single control lets you scroll through brightness levels, navigate the pixel display menus, and play games. The fidget aspect is a deliberate design choice for enthusiasts who enjoy objects they can manipulate.
High Performance Flashlight: Beneath the pixel display, the LOOPDOT is a serious tool. It delivers a maximum output of 400 lumens with a high CRI of 90, which means colors look natural and accurate. It offers stepless dimming, allowing you to dial in the exact brightness you need, from a gentle glow to full power illumination.
Dual Light Sources and Stepless Dimming: The LOOPDOT features both a spotlight and a floodlight mode. The brightness of each can be adjusted seamlessly with the fidget dial. You can even switch between modes with a simple flick of the wrist thanks to a built in motion sensor.
Durable and Water Resistant Build: The body of the LOOPDOT is crafted from sand-blasted aluminum or titanium with a curved tempered glass on the front. It has an IPX6 rating, which means it can withstand rain and brief submersion, and it is designed to handle the daily abuse of everyday carry. It also includes a magnetic base for flexible mounting options.

The Idea
Concept: The core concept of the LOOPDOT is to bridge the gap between a high performance everyday tool and a fun, interactive gadget. LOOPGEAR's goal was to rethink the traditional flashlight by adding a layer of playfulness and personality through the use of a pixel display and a fidget dial. The project aims to provide a device that is not only useful for illumination but also serves as a source of entertainment and self expression.
Inspiration: The creators at LOOPGEAR were inspired by retro gadgets like the Tamagotchi, with its pixel-based interface, and modern tech like the Apple Watch, with its rotating crown. They also recognized that EDC enthusiasts love objects that are tactile and engaging. The LOOPDOT is a direct result of combining these inspirations to create a product that is both a tribute to the past and a look towards the future of personal gadgets.
